mls qos map cos-queue to

Overview
Use this command to set the default CoS to egress queue mapping. This is the
default queue mapping for packets that do not get assigned an egress queue via
any other QoS functionality.
Use the no variant of this command to reset the cos-queue map back to its default
setting. The default mappings for this command are:
